Title:Research and experiment on closed die forging process for automobile gear shaft

Abstract:

 For the problems of low efficiency, poor quality and short service life for automobile gear shaft produced by traditional forging process or casting process, according to the process requirements and the characteristics of gear shaft, two kinds of die forging processes, namely small flash die forging process and closed die forging process, were proposed. Then, two kinds of die forging processes for gear shaft were simulated by rigid plastic finite element method and software Deform-3D, and the material filling law, the stress distribution law, the change laws of forming force and die clamping force, and the forming quality of gear shaft forgings were comprehensively analyzed. The results show that both two kinds of die forging processes can form gear shaft forgings, but the quality of gear shaft forgings obtained by closed die forging process is better, and it is also more conducive to the improvement of die life. Finally, it is verified by the closed die forging test that all parts of the obtained gear shaft forgings are fully filled and meet the design requirements.
